Kremik Marina
HR 22202 Primosten, Splitska 22-24
Tel:+385 22 570 068, Fax:+385 22 571 142, VHF Channel 17
info@marina-kremik.hr
43deg 34'02N, 15deg 50'06'E.
Marina Kremik is in the northern arm of Luka Peles which is about 3M NW of Rogoznica. It is a summer port of entry and sailing permits can be issued at the marina where police and customs are in attendance.
260 wet berths and 150 dry berths. Max depth 5m. Open all year. Well protected marina. Full yard with good range of services, 10t crane, 80 ton travelift and 50 ton slipway. Diesel engine, outboards, metalwork, electrical, fireglass repair and maintenance. Taxi service on request. Fuel station within marina. Internet and WLAN.
